    Looking for software for general STL viewing as well as seeing if anyone has tried to hook their android tablet up to a 3d printer.. While doing that ran across:

    http://www.dietzm.de/gcodesim/

    No clue if it works with Robo3d as I'm still waiting on mine. It isn't pretty, and unsure how one is suppose to configure it. But for smaller parts (with well generate gcode) it seems to operator well.

    The STL viewer I've fallen in love with is.

    https://play.google.com/store/apps/details?id=com.rootzero.graphite&hl=en

    It has already been extremely useful in helping me find odd-ball flaws that are hard to see well in Blender.

    A bit of warning about both.. Your stl/gcode must be well formated. Any holes, mangled faces, etc and they crash hard. =)
